Head Calibration Data Backup/Restoration Procedures
Backup procedure
(1) Press the 6 and 8 keys in this order in the initial stage of the maintenance mode.
(2) Press the 0, 6, 2, and 6 keys in this order.
The "Write Head Calib" appears on the LCD.
(3) Insert an external memory into the memory slot.
(4) Use the and keys to display "Head Calib->Media" on the LCD and then press the OK
key.
The machine displays "Now Saving" on the LCD and starts the backup operation.
Note: If no external memory is inserted into the memory slot in step (3), the machine
sounds a short beep three times and displays "No Media Error" on the LCD.
Upon completion of the backup operation, the machine beeps for one second, displays
"Head Calib.data" on the LCD, and then returns to the initial stage of the maintenance
mode.
Restoration procedure
(1) Press the 6 and 8 keys in this order in the initial stage of the maintenance mode.
(2) Press the 0, 6, 2, and 6 keys in this order.
The "Write Head Calib" appears on the LCD.
(3) Insert the external memory holding the head property data into the memory slot.
(4) Use the and keys to display "Media->Head Calib" on the LCD and then press the OK
key.
The machine displays "Now Loading" on the LCD and starts the restoration operation.
Note: If no external memory is inserted into the memory slot in step (3), the machine
sounds a short beep three times and displays "No Media Error" on the LCD.
Note: If the external memory inserted in step (3) holds no head calibration data, the "Can’t
Open File" appears on the LCD.
Upon completion of the restoration operation, the machine beeps for one second, displays
"Complete" on the LCD, and then returns to the initial stage of the maintenance mode.
